Gentleness vs Weakness
One of the most important clarifications in Rick Warren gentleness teaching is the difference between gentleness and weakness. Many people mistakenly think that being gentle means being passive or unable to defend oneself.
However, gentleness actually requires strength, discipline, and emotional control.
Key Differences
- Gentleness controlled strength
- Weakness lack of strength or control
- Gentleness intentional kindness
- Weakness inability to respond effectively

Jesus as the Model of Gentleness
In Rick Warren’s teachings, Jesus Christ is the ultimate example of gentleness. Despite having great authority and power, Jesus consistently showed compassion, patience, and humility in His interactions.
This model encourages believers to follow the same approach in their own lives.
Characteristics of Jesus’ Gentleness
- Calm response to criticism
- Compassion toward others
- Forgiveness even under pressure
- Humility in leadership
